ReactOS as a Rescue System?
there are many linux based live rescue systems out there, and it's possible to make windows based ones. but is it possible to do the same with reactos? i'd love to take the reactos live iso, put some helpful windows tools on it (that aren't available on linux rescue discs) and boot it up in case i need it. i just don't like having to use windows for my windows rescuing, so if it were possible to do with reactos that'd be great.

In the past, I've tried using an ISO modification tool to add programs to the "All Users" desktop, but ended up breaking the 'bootable' part of the LiveCD, which effectively made it useless. I'm sure with the right combination of tools and know-how, someone could actually manage to customize one though.

Re: ReactOS as a Rescue System?
First of all, ReactOS should have RAM disk driver with write support.
Currently it works in read-only mode.
